Kinder Academy is an international preschool founded in 2016 that provides both full English and bilingual English-Vietnamese curricula for children aged 12 months to 6 years. It focuses on cognitive, social, and emotional development within a safe, nurturing, and play-based environment.

Teaching approach

The school follows a child-centered, inquiry-based philosophy that prioritizes well-being and holistic development. It emphasizes the importance of early brain growth through play-based learning, hands-on activities, and experiential projects. The school fosters international-mindedness, encouraging empathy, respect, and a sense of responsibility toward the global community and the planet.

Programmes

The school offers three main age-based programs: the Nursery group (12–36 months) focused on sensory and language exploration; the Preschool group (3–4 years) focused on motor and problem-solving skills; and the Pre-Kindergarten/Kindergarten group (4–6 years) focused on early literacy and creative thinking. The curriculum integrates STEAM education, creative arts, and language development, with the bilingual track adhering to Vietnamese Education Department standards. All programs are available in three or five full-day options per week.

About the campus

The 1,800 sqm campus is designed to balance learning and play, with two-thirds of the space dedicated to lush green playgrounds and gardens. Facilities include an inviting swimming pool, a nature play area, and dedicated garden spaces where children participate in weekly gardening activities. The environment is intentionally structured to encourage connection to nature and active exploration.

Co-curriculars

Enrichment activities are held weekly throughout the academic year, featuring specialist-led sessions in swimming, music, sports, and visual arts. These programs are designed to foster creativity, confidence, and new skill development in a supportive environment. Additionally, the school hosts seasonal camps, such as the Autumn Camp, which incorporate coding, art, and swimming.
